The Northern Marianas College Beta Lambda Psi Chapter of Phi Theta Kappa International Honor Society celebrated the induction of twenty new members into the Society on Saturday, April 13. Family, friends, PTK members and adviser Larry Lee, NMC president Sharon Hart, Ph.D., and Associated Students of NMC vice president Richard Pizarro joined in the festivities at the Pacific Islands Club Charley's Cabaret to honor the new inductees.....full story |

Huaqiao University and the University of Guam met in April to finalize plans for a student exchange program for the fall 2013 semester. Up to five students will have the opportunity to gain an international experience in tourism when they apply to take courses to attend at each other's institutions. This relationship is in line with the Cooperation of Agreement for student exchange between HQU and UOG, which was signed in late 2012.....full story |
